Handover: Exportron retry queue

Hi Mira — handing over the failed-export retries. Exports that hit a timeout land in the retry queue and get three attempts with backoff; after that they're parked and need a manual requeue from the admin panel. Watch for customers reporting duplicates — that usually means a double requeue. The current retry settings are as follows.

settings of bajog-fawig:
oliael:
  log_level: warn
  metrics_host: metrics.oliael.zemvarsys.internal
  pin: 0267
  pool_size: 32

## Step 4: Enable the Bloom Filter

As discussed at last week's sync, we're putting a bloom filter in front of the Cellarstone KV store to cut pointless disk lookups on the read path. Expected false-positive rate is under one percent at current key counts. Don't enable this until the backfill from Step 3 finishes, or the filter will be useless. Once backfill completes, apply the settings shown below.

deployment values, kajep-kageg:
[praix]
host = praix.paliqcorp.corp
user = praix_svc
database = praix_prod

## Local Setup: Export Service

The Brindlewood spreadsheet exporter streams rows to avoid loading full sheets into memory; please verify the reviewer notes on chunk sizing in `export/stream.go`. Run with the 512MB container limit to reproduce the regression. Seed the fixtures, then point the service at your local database via the string below.

replica DSN, fawif-fahaf: clickhouse://ralvan_svc:hJSsNCc@db-e396.plorvadata.corp:5432/holius

Internal Memo — Divestiture of the Calloway Fixtures Unit

To all sales leads: following the strategic review, Drayhurst Industries has agreed in principle to sell the Calloway Fixtures unit to an external buyer. Customer accounts tied to Calloway products will transition over two quarters; commission structures for affected territories remain unchanged through the transition. Please do not discuss the sale externally until the formal announcement. For your planning only, the confidential summary of next steps is set out below.

management briefing: Istaelix Group is in early talks to buy Sorysax Logistics for about $496.2 million. The Kasox launch date is October 3, and nothing goes to the press before then. Legal wants the Norokax Foods term sheet withdrawn before April 25.